Glad I could help. Iconx is one of those neat little tools that most folks
don't seem to know about. You can use it to create an entire environment,
if you want, using an elaborate script. You can copy files that are used a
lot to a RAM: disk for your session, to cut down on drive access and
increase speed, "cd" to any directory before staring up the main program,
and then have the whole thing cleaned up when you shut down (I do this when
I'm playing around with C, for example). Whatever you can do with a
script, you can do automagically from an icon with iconx.
